1、计算机基础,理论成绩 考勤(10%) 大作业一(15%) 大作业二(15%) 期末考试(60%),第一讲 计算机基本知识,一、计算机的发展概况 二、计算机的基本原理 三、计算机的分类 四、计算机的应用,一、电子计算机的发展概况,1.第一台电子计算机,ENIAC:Electronic Numerical Integrator And Calculator (电子数字积分器和计算器)1946年4月,美陆军阿伯丁弹道实验室,占地170m2,重30吨,18800个电子管,1500个继电器,7000个电阻,耗电150千瓦,5000次/秒,第一代计算机:电子管计算机时代(19461958)器件:电子管 软
2、件:机器语言、汇编语言 应用:科学计算第二代计算机:晶体管计算机时代(19591964)器件:晶体管 软件:高级语言 应用:数据处理、工业控制 第三代计算机:集成电路计算机时代(19651970)器件:集成电路 软件:操作系统 应用:文字处理、图形处理第四代计算机:大规模、超大规模集成电路计算机时代 (1971至今)器件:大规模集成电路 软件:数据库、网络等 应用:社会各领域,2. 计算机发展的四个时代,3. 未来计算机的发展展望,生物计算机 量子计算机 光子计算机 分子计算机,二. 计算机的基本原理,第一台真正具有现代计算机结构的电子计算机EDVAC: Electric Discrete V
3、ariable Automatic Computer (电子离散变量自动计算机) 采用二进制并能存储程序和数据-冯.诺依曼计算机,其运算速度是ENIAC的240倍。,计算机的特点,电子计算机(简称计算机,又称电脑、信息处理机)是一种能够高速、自动地进行信息处理的电子设备。它具有如下特点:(1) 速度快(2) 精度高(3) 存储容量大(4) 通用性强(5) 具有逻辑判断和自动控制能力,三、计算机的分类,按计算机的功能分:专用计算机和通用计算机,Altair 8800,计算机发展方向微型化,计算机不再是单一的计算机器,而是一种 信息机器,一种个人的信息机器。,CRAY-,计算机发展方向巨型化,运算
4、速度可达每秒万亿次运算的超级计算机1975年世界上第一台超级计算机“Cray-I” 超级计算机应用:天气预报、地震机理研究、 石油和地质勘探,卫星图像处理等大量科学计 算的高科技领域。,中国的超级计算机: 国防科技大学研制的 “银河1号”、 “银河2号”和“银河3号”国家智能计算机中心推出的 “曙光1000”,“曙光2000” “曙光4000A”,银河,巨型机,全球最快10台超级计算机系统排名() 1、NEC公司研制的“地球模拟器”。 35.86万亿/次 2、加利福尼亚数字公司为劳伦斯-利弗莫尔国家实验室研制的Thunder。 3、惠普公司为洛斯-阿拉莫斯国家实验室研制的ASCIQ。 4、IB
5、M研制的“蓝色基因/L DD1”原型系统。 5、戴尔公司为美国超级计算应用中心研制的Tungsten。 6、IBM公司为欧洲中期天气预报中心研制的二台基于Power4芯片的系统。 7、富士通公司研制的“超级组合机群系统”。 8、IBM研制的“蓝色基因/L DD2”原型系统。 9、惠普公司为美国西北太平洋国家实验室研制的基于安腾芯片的机群系统。 10、中国曙光计算机公司为上海超级计算机中心研制的“曙光4000A”。 8万亿/次,计算机发展方向网络化,计算机网络: 计算机技术与通信技术结合 的产物。 计算机网络的发展动力: 使用远程资源,共享程序、 数据和信息资源,网络用户 的通讯和合作。,计算机发展方向智能化,计算机将依据不确定的输入作出决定,它模仿人脑的工作方式,具有直观判断和处理不完整的模糊信息的能力,甚至有接近人的审美和情感能力。 计算机工作时只需有人告诉它“做什么”,而不必“手把手”教它“怎样做”。,四、计算机的应用,科学计算(数值计算) 数据处理(信息处理) 自动控制 计算机辅助设计和辅助教学 人工智能方面的研究和应用 多媒体技术应用 虚拟现实,